[ZTA] Accounts/Groups(IdP)
- New Group button: Register a new group from external IdP integrated with Safous.
- Status: Shows the current status of the group, indicating whether it is active (enabled) or inactive (disabled).
- Name: Shows the name of the group.
- Identity Provider: Shows the name of the source integrated external IdP.
- Expand/Shrink button: A '+' button to expand and a '–' button to shrink the group's detailed information.
- Edit button: Allow modification of the group's name, IdP, and attribute.
- Delete button: Delete the group.
- Group Name: Name of the group in Safous. Must be unique among all groups from all external IdPs.
- Status: Shows the current status of the group, indicating whether it is active (enabled) or inactive (disabled). Can also be toggled on (enabled) or off (disabled).
- Grant access to Recording data: Control whether the members in the group can access recording data or not.
- Identity Provider: List of integrated External IdPs. Select the IdP where the group came from.
- Attribute/Free Query: Choose whether the group should be identified by using its attribute from the external IdP or by using free query. For more details, please refer to this article.
- If Attribute: Can be used on all supported external IdPs (AD/LDAP, SAML, OpenID).
- Expected value: The expected value that identifies the group within that IdP. Differs for each IdP.
- Attribute: The attribute name for group object in that IdP. Differs for each IdP.
- If Free Query: Can only be used on AD/LDAP and SAML IdPs.
- Matching Query: The format of query that matches the group's identity in the integrated external IdP.
- If AD/LDAP: The full LDAP query.
- If SAML: The XPath query to match the values expected from the given group.
